I expect a lot of "day 1", "don't let him get you on fire then" blah blah blah, though I definitely think it's an issue that Forward Strong kills much earlier than Up Strong, considering how much easier it is to land. (It's worth noting that Wolf's version of that move was never his most potent kill option). It simply seems like too good of a footsie tool to kill that early. This would give you a good incentive to use Zetterburn's other tools, while still proving this move as a reliable failsafe if you can't get the kill before then. I'd probably like to see Forward Strong lose about half its current kill power, so it would reliably kill around 110-120% if the opponent was on fire. Zetterburn has some sick combos that let him combo into Up Strong, but there's really just not a lot of point going for them when you can usually just get the kill with Forward Strong at the same percents. In particular, I feel there is almost no point doing combos with Zetterburn, because a simple Dash Attack Forward Strong combo kills at like 60% if they're on fire (I don't think this is escapable at that percent, but even if it forward strong is such a good footsie tool it almost doesn't matter, it's never a hard move to land). So far, the only issue that stands out to me is Zetterburn's Forward Strong, which I feel has significantly too much knockback, to the point that it basically trivializes half his moveset.
